Egg Salad with Avocado on Baguette
A quick and easy appetizer or a sandwich.

Ingredients
  1. 8 boiled eggs, chopped
  2. 1-2 Tbsp. Dijon mustard
  3. 1-2 Tbsp. whole grain mustard
  4. 1 large avocado, peeled, cut into 1/4" dice
  5. 1/3 c. mayonnaise, or more if needed
  6. 1 stalk celery, finely chopped
  7. 1/2-1 tsp. lemon juice
  8. 1 tsp dried dill
  9. 1-2 tsp. olive oil
  10. salt and pepper
  11. radishes, sliced thin for garnish
  12. prosciutto, baked and crumbled (or bacon)
  13. baguette, sliced thin
  14. 1/3 c. butter, melted
  15. 1/4 tsp. garlic powder
Instructions
  1. Put the prosciutto on a cookie sheet and bake at 350° until nice and brown, cool then crumble. Set aside for garnish
  2. For the avocado, peel and remove pit. Drop in cool water for a couple of minutes. When ready to add to the egg salad, chop into 1/4" pieces.
  3. Peel the boiled eggs and using an egg slicer, cut one way then the other, making small pieces. I don't like my egg salad mashed. mix the eggs, dijon mustard, whole grain mustard, mayonnaise, celery, lemon juice, dill, 1-2 tsp. olive oil, salt and pepper to taste. After mixing this well, without mashing your eggs to much, gently stir in the avocado.
  4. Slice the baguette into diagonal slices. Mix the butter and the garlic powder. Brush slices with melted butter and lightly brown in 350° oven. When cool, top with a scoop of egg/avocado salad, add a little radish for garnish and a sprinkle of prosciutto or bacon.
  5. You can adjust the mustard and mayonnaise to how you like your egg salad.
Notes
  1. I would start with one tablespoon of the mustards and if you need more add it. You may want it more mustardy than mayonnaise taste.
